Real-time, distributed measurement of detonation velocities inside high explosives with the help of chirped fiber bragg gratings

Abstract

Following the pioneering work of the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ory, Chirped Fiber Bragg Gratings are investigated as in situ, real-time, wavelength-position discriminators for measuring detonation speeds inside explosives.
